Personal Loan But Bad Credit
Bad credit personal loan applications can be difficult to get approved. Lenders are often hesitant to offer financing to those with a poor credit history, as it may indicate that they are a greater risk for defaulting on the loan. However, there are steps individuals can take to improve their chances of getting approved for a bad credit personal loan.

International Olympic Day 2023. Content Warning.
International Olympic Day is an annual celebration held on June 23rd to commemorate the founding of the modern Olympic Games. In this article, we explore the significance and history of International Olympic Day, highlighting its theme for 2023 and the importance of this global event in promoting unity, athleticism, and the Olympic values.
